Original text and translations

Image:English.png English text

Translation from original Greek text by Robert Bridges (1844 - 1930)

1. O Gladsome light, O grace
Of God the father's face.
The eternal spendor wearing:
Celestial, holy, blest.
Our Saviour Jesus Christ,
Joyful in thine appearing.


2. Now ere day fadeth quite,
We see the evening light.
Our wonted hymn outpouring.
Father of might unknown,
Thee, His incarnate Son,
And Holy Spirit adoring.


3. To thee of right belongs
all praise of holy songs.
O Son of God, lifegiver;
Thee, therefore, O Most High,
The world doth glorify,
And shall exalt forever.


Amen.
